#fbb724 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fbb724 is composed of 98.4% red, 71.8%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 41 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#fbb724 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#f76f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#fbb724 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fbb724 has RGB values of R:251, G:183,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.86,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16496420.

Hex triplet fbb724 #fbb724
RGB Decimal 251, 183, 36 rgb(251,183,36)
RGB Percent 98.4, 71.8, 14.1 rgb(98.4%,71.8%,14.1%)
CMYK 0, 27, 86, 2
HSL 41°, 96.4, 56.3 hsl(41,96.4%,56.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 41°, 85.7, 98.4
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 78.756, 13.305, 75.656
XYZ 57.037, 54.507, 9.186
xyY 0.472, 0.451, 54.507
CIE-LCH 78.756, 76.817, 80.026
CIE-LUV 78.756, 56.351, 77.202
Hunter-Lab 73.829, 8.701, 44.303
Binary 11111011, 10110111, 00100100

Shades and Tints of #fbb724

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0800 is the darkest color, while #fffd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fbb724

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94918b is the less saturated color, while #fbb724 is the most saturated one.
